mirror of
https://github.com/xcat2/xcat-core.git
synced 2025-07-22 12:21:10 +00:00
62 lines
966 B
Plaintext
62 lines
966 B
Plaintext
start:rvitals_temp
|
|
arch:ppc64le
|
|
hcp:ipmi
|
|
cmd:rvitals $$CN temp
|
|
check:rc==0
|
|
check:output=~Ambient Temp
|
|
end
|
|
|
|
start:rvitals_disktemp
|
|
arch:ppc64le
|
|
hcp:ipmi
|
|
cmd:rvitals $$CN disktemp
|
|
check:rc==0
|
|
check:output=~Ambient Temp
|
|
end
|
|
|
|
start:rvitals_cputemp
|
|
arch:ppc64le
|
|
hcp:ipmi
|
|
cmd:rvitals $$CN cputemp
|
|
check:rc==0
|
|
check:output=~Ambient Temp
|
|
end
|
|
|
|
start:rvitals_fanspeed
|
|
arch:ppc64le
|
|
hcp:ipmi
|
|
cmd:rvitals $$CN fanspeed
|
|
check:rc==0
|
|
check:output=~Fan\s*\d:\s*\w+\s*RPM
|
|
end
|
|
|
|
start:rvitals_voltage
|
|
arch:ppc64le
|
|
hcp:ipmi
|
|
cmd:rvitals $$CN voltage
|
|
check:rc==0
|
|
check:output=~CPU VDD Volt
|
|
end
|
|
|
|
start:rvitals_all
|
|
arch:ppc64le
|
|
hcp:ipmi
|
|
cmd:rvitals $$CN all
|
|
check:rc==0
|
|
check:output=~Power Status
|
|
check:output=~Power Overload
|
|
check:output=~Power Interlock
|
|
check:output=~Power Fault
|
|
check:output=~Power Control Fault
|
|
check:output=~Power Restore Policy
|
|
check:output=~Ambient Temp
|
|
end
|
|
|
|
start:rvitals_noderange_err
|
|
arch:ppc64le
|
|
hcp:ipmi
|
|
cmd:rvitals testnode
|
|
check:rc!=0
|
|
check:output=~Error
|
|
end
|